Каким образом гарантируется корректность функционирования программных систем

Каким образом гарантируется корректность функционирования программных систем

Стабильность работы программ считается фундаментальным условием к любому информационному сервису. Безотносительно к уровня системы — от компактного утилитарного приложения до сложной распределенной архитектуры — приложение необходимо чтобы исполнять определенные функции надежно, контролируемо и без отклонений результата. Гарантирование корректности не сводится созданием функционального кода. Это Platinum Casino комплексный подход, содержащий проектирование, проверку, контроль входных параметров, отслеживание и регулярную сопровождение, и это глубоко освещается в аналитических материалах казино платинум.

Программа исполняется в определенной операционной среде: системная ОС, аппаратные ресурсы, коммуникационное контекст, интегрированные службы. Любое даже незначительное обновление этих условий способно скорректировать на работу приложения. Следовательно устойчивость понимается не исключительно как минимизация ошибок в реализации, а и как способность решения поддерживать устойчивость при изменяющихся сценариях работы.

Структурирование требований и формализованное задание

Гарантирование корректности стартует существенно раньше прежде чем реализации алгоритма. На первом этапе разрабатывается формализованное задание, где фиксируются функции приложения, варианты использования, пределы и планируемые выходы. Ясно сформулированные требования дают возможность минимизировать неоднозначностей а также логических конфликтов в коде.

Критически важно определить крайние параметры, нестандартные случаи и разрешенные расхождения. Если критерии остаются нечеткими, корректность оказывается условной характеристикой. Формализация критериев делает реализуемой проверяемую валидацию совпадения решения требованиям Платинум Казино.

Также формируются рабочие модели а также карты взаимодействий, показывающие логику действий в пределах приложения. Подобные описания позволяют выявлять логические ошибки ещё до этапа программирования и исправлять структуру разрабатываемого продукта.

Разработка архитектуры а также логики кода

Профессионально организованная архитектура существенно уменьшает шанс сбоев. Декомпозиция программы на независимые блоки, соблюдение правил разграничения и минимизация зависимостей между модулями укрепляют надежность приложения. Изолированные части удобнее анализировать и обновлять без искажения общей корректности.

Четкая структура программы облегчает поддержку и анализ. Применение понятных имен функций Казино Платинум, а также придерживание стандартизированных конвенций реализации минимизирует риск неочевидных структурных дефектов.

Важным плюсом является способность расширения проекта. Если части программы изолированы, их возможно обновлять независимо, поддерживая общую стабильность приложения.

Статический анализ и аудит программы

Перед запуска программы в работу осуществляется анализ алгоритмов. Статический контроль находит вероятные ошибки, несоответствия структуры и некорректные конструкции. Специализированные средства Platinum Casino дают возможность выявлять распространенные дефекты на раннем этапе.

Проверка программных модулей со стороны независимых экспертов даёт возможность распознать архитектурные ошибки, которые в состоянии оказаться неочевидными для автора реализации. Совместная проверка улучшает надежность программы и обеспечивает стандартизацию проектных решений.

В процессе аудита также анализируется читаемость и расширяемость реализации, что важно для длительной развития а также снижения роста технических проблем.

Многоуровневое валидация

Тестирование выступает ключевым способом подтверждения стабильности. Юнит испытания Платинум Казино валидируют конкретные методы, совместные — работу между модулями, системные — поведение программы в полном объеме. Подобный поэтапный метод поддерживает полную валидацию надежности.

Ключевое значение занимают тесты на крайние условия и нештатные сценарии. Дефекты как правило возникают при обработке с максимальными данными, в отсутствии данных или в непредсказуемых структурах поступающей параметров.

Параллельно используются контрольные испытания, которые подтвердить, что внесенные обновленные обновления не нарушили ранее компоненты программы. Это Казино Платинум поддерживает стабильность в процессе развития решения.

Валидация входных параметров

Программа обязана стабильно интерпретировать входные параметры вне зависимости от их источника. Контроль формата, пределов показателей и required атрибутов исключает осуществление ошибочных вычислений. Проверка защищает систему от алгоритмических сбоев и непредсказуемого поведения.

Кроме к тому же, критично реализовать защиту от намеренно ошибочных вводов. Очистка а также валидация содержания поступающих данных снижают повреждение корректности программы.

Системная ревизия качества наборов Platinum Casino позволяет сохранять стабильность механизмов обработки и повышает качество результатов работы приложения.

Обработка исключений

Даже при глубоком тестировании целиком предотвратить возникновение дефектов невозможно. Вследствие этого система необходимо чтобы содержать процедуры обработки исключений. В случае появлении ошибки программа обязана в идеале корректно остановить выполнение, или перейти в контролируемое формат.

Логирование сбоев помогает изучать источники сбоев и предотвращать их в следующих обновлениях. Недостаток эффективной механики управления сбоев в состоянии привести к каскадным сбоям в функционировании системы.

Четкие сообщения Платинум Казино об ошибках позволяют эффективнее диагностировать неполадки а также упрощают обслуживание приложения.

Управление устойчивости

Надежность подразумевает не лишь верность вычислений, но и устойчивость функционирования во реальных условиях. Система должна адекватно исполняться при изменяющихся объемах операций, не допуская перерасхода памяти, зависаний а также ухудшения производительности.

Стрессовое тестирование даёт возможность обнаружить узкие места и изучить поведение системы при повышенной активности операций. Настройка вычислений поддерживает устойчивость исполнения в перспективной эксплуатации.

Регулярный анализ показателей даёт возможность оперативно выявлять симптомы деградации эффективности и избегать сбои.

Отслеживание после внедрения

Даже после выпуска системы необходим непрерывный мониторинг. Отслеживание помогает контролировать основные показатели: частоту отказов, скорость реакции, использование памяти. Разбор этих метрик даёт возможность своевременно распознавать нарушения.

Быстрое реагирование при аномальные показатели исключает эскалацию масштабных сбоев и сохраняет корректность работы в реальных режимах Казино Платинум.

Также используются механизмы уведомлений, которые позволяют информировать специалистов о серьёзных сбоях в режиме онлайн момента.

Отслеживание версий

Обновление системы закономерно включает с реализацией изменений. Использование механизмов управления кода позволяет регистрировать любую правку и анализировать её воздействие на корректность. Это облегчает откат к проверенному версии в обнаружении сбоев.

Контролируемое развертывание обновлений и обязательное валидация каждой сборки позволяют обеспечивать стабильность системы и предотвратить критических сбоев.

Лог версий является средством отслеживания модификаций программы и даёт возможность обнаруживать хронические ошибки.

Защищенность как компонент надежности

Нарушение безопасности может привести к подмене информации и некорректной функционированию программы. В связи с этим обеспечение безопасности от стороннего доступа, ограничение полномочий участников и периодическое актуализация компонентов становятся элементом поддержания корректности Platinum Casino.

Криптографическая защита и контроль сетевых соединений предотвращают сторонние нарушения, которые могут исказить функционирование системы.

Периодические оценки защитных механизмов помогают обнаруживать риски до того, если они приведут к реальным нарушениям.

Сопровождение

Подробная документация упрощает сопровождение программы и минимизирует шанс ошибок в расширении. Документирование архитектуры функционирования помогает новым специалистам эффективно разбираться в организации системы.

Периодическое обновление документации обеспечивает актуальность текущему уровню программы и поддерживает стабильность в процессе их эволюции.

Грамотно оформленные руководства дополнительно облегчают освоение дополнительных модулей Платинум Казино и ускоряют адаптацию пользователей.

Заключение

Корректность работы приложений поддерживается системным подходом, включающим точную постановку условий, продуманную реализацию, проверку, мониторинг и контроль обновлениями. Это Казино Платинум служит постоянным циклом, сопровождающим весь эксплуатационный цикл продукта.

Только сочетание программной аккуратности, структурного контроля и непрерывного наблюдения позволяет гарантировать стабильность информационных систем в контексте развивающейся эксплуатации.

Scroll to Top